Comprehensive Database
PayScale offers a large and comprehensive database of salary information across various industries and job roles, which helps users make informed decisions about their career and compensation packages.
User-Friendly Interface
The website is designed with a user-friendly interface that facilitates easy navigation and quick access to relevant tools and information.
Custom Salary Reports
PayScale provides customized salary reports based on specific criteria such as job title, location, experience, and education, offering detailed insights into expected compensation.
Free Basic Information
Users can access basic salary information for free, which is helpful for initial research and general understanding of market trends.
Employer Solutions
PayScale offers a range of solutions for employers, including compensation management software and analytics, which aid businesses in developing competitive and fair compensation strategies.
Salary Negotiation Guidance
The platform provides resources and advice on salary negotiation, empowering users to confidently discuss compensation with potential or current employers.
PayScale is a reliable and well-regarded resource for salary information and compensation analysis. It is especially beneficial for those seeking updated and accurate data to negotiate salaries or to benchmark positions within their organization.

Check the traffic stats of PayScale on SimilarWeb. The key metrics to look for are: monthly visits, average visit duration, pages per visit, and traffic by country. Moreoever, check the traffic sources. For example "Direct" traffic is a good sign.
Check the "Domain Rating" of PayScale on Ahrefs. The domain rating is a measure of the strength of a website's backlink profile on a scale from 0 to 100. It shows the strength of PayScale's backlink profile compared to the other websites. In most cases a domain rating of 60+ is considered good and 70+ is considered very good.
Check the "Domain Authority" of PayScale on MOZ. A website's domain authority (DA) is a search engine ranking score that predicts how well a website will rank on search engine result pages (SERPs). It is based on a 100-point logarithmic scale, with higher scores corresponding to a greater likelihood of ranking. This is another useful metric to check if a website is good.

One place to start is with online salary calculators such as Glassdoor and Payscale. These tools allow you to input your job title, location, and other relevant information to get an estimate of the average salary for that role in a specific area. It's important to note that these estimates are based on self-reported data, so the accuracy may vary, but it gives you a good idea to work if. - Source: dev.to / over 3 years ago
